/**
* \brief An owning, read-only sequence of fields.
* \details
* Although owning, `row` is read-only. It's optimized for memory re-use. If you need to mutate
* fields, use a `std::vector<field>` instead (see \ref row_view::as_vector and \ref
* row::as_vector).
*
* \par Object lifetimes
* A `row` object owns a chunk of memory in which it stores its elements. On element access (using
* iterators, \ref row::at or \ref row::operator[]) it returns \ref field_view's pointing into the
* `row`'s internal storage. These views behave like references, and are valid as long as pointers,
* iterators and references into the `row` remain valid.
*/
class row
{
detail::row_impl impl_;
public:
#ifdef BOOST_MYSQL_DOXYGEN
/**
* \brief A random access iterator to an element.
* \details The exact type of the iterator is unspecified.
*/
using iterator = __see_below__;
#else
using iterator = const field_view*;
#endif
/// \copydoc iterator
using const_iterator = iterator;
/// A type that can hold elements in this collection with value semantics.
using value_type = field;
/// The reference type.
using reference = field_view;
/// \copydoc reference
using const_reference = field_view;
/// An unsigned integer type to represent sizes.
using size_type = std::size_t;
/// A signed integer type used to represent differences.
using difference_type = std::ptrdiff_t;
/**
* \brief Constructs an empty row.
* \par Exception safety
* No-throw guarantee.
*/
row() = default;
/**
* \brief Copy constructor.
* \par Exception safety
* Strong guarantee. Internal allocations may throw.
*
* \par Object lifetimes
* `*this` lifetime will be independent of `other`'s.
*
* \par Complexity
* Linear on `other.size()`.
*/
row(const row& other) = default;
/**
* \brief Move constructor.
* \par Exception safety
* No-throw guarantee.
*
* \par Object lifetimes
* Iterators and references (including \ref row_view's and \ref field_view's) to
* elements in `other` remain valid.
*
* \par Complexity
* Constant.
*/
row(row&& other) = default;
/**
* \brief Copy assignment.
* \par Exception safety
* Basic guarantee. Internal allocations may throw.
*
* \par Object lifetimes
* `*this` lifetime will be independent of `other`'s. Iterators and references
* (including \ref row_view's and \ref field_view's) to elements in `*this` are invalidated.
*
* \par Complexity
* Linear on `this->size()` and `other.size()`.
*/
row& operator=(const row& other) = default;
/**
* \brief Move assignment.
* \par Exception safety
* No-throw guarantee.
*
* \par Object lifetimes
* Iterators and references (including \ref row_view's and \ref field_view's) to
* elements in `*this` are invalidated. Iterators and references to elements in `other` remain
* valid.
*
* \par Complexity
* Constant.
*/
row& operator=(row&& other) = default;
/**
* \brief Destructor.
*/
~row() = default;
/**
* \brief Constructs a row from a \ref row_view.
* \par Exception safety
* Strong guarantee. Internal allocations may throw.
*
* \par Object lifetimes
* `*this` lifetime will be independent of `r`'s (the contents of `r` will be copied
* into `*this`).
*
* \par Complexity
* Linear on `r.size()`.
*/
row(row_view r) : impl_(r.begin(), r.size()) {}
/**
* \brief Replaces the contents with a \ref row_view.
* \par Exception safety
* Basic guarantee. Internal allocations may throw.
*
* \par Object lifetimes
* `*this` lifetime will be independent of `r`'s (the contents of `r` will be copied
* into `*this`). Iterators and references (including \ref row_view's and \ref field_view's) to
* elements in `*this` are invalidated.
*
* \par Complexity
* Linear on `this->size()` and `r.size()`.
*/
row& operator=(row_view r)
{
impl_.assign(r.begin(), r.size());
return *this;
}
/// \copydoc row_view::begin
const_iterator begin() const noexcept { return impl_.fields().data(); }
/// \copydoc row_view::end
const_iterator end() const noexcept { return impl_.fields().data() + impl_.fields().size(); }
/// \copydoc row_view::at
field_view at(std::size_t i) const { return impl_.fields().at(i); }
/// \copydoc row_view::operator[]
field_view operator[](std::size_t i) const noexcept { return impl_.fields()[i]; }
/// \copydoc row_view::front
field_view front() const noexcept { return impl_.fields().front(); }
/// \copydoc row_view::back
field_view back() const noexcept { return impl_.fields().back(); }
/// \copydoc row_view::empty
bool empty() const noexcept { return impl_.fields().empty(); }
/// \copydoc row_view::size
std::size_t size() const noexcept { return impl_.fields().size(); }
/**
* \brief Creates a \ref row_view that references `*this`.
* \par Exception safety
* No-throw guarantee.
*
* \par Object lifetimes
* The returned view will be valid until any function that invalidates iterators and
* references is invoked on `*this` or `*this` is destroyed.
*
* \par Complexity
* Constant.
*/
operator row_view() const noexcept { return row_view(impl_.fields().data(), impl_.fields().size()); }
/// \copydoc row_view::as_vector
template <class Allocator>
void as_vector(std::vector<field, Allocator>& out) const
{
out.assign(begin(), end());
}
/// \copydoc row_view::as_vector
std::vector<field> as_vector() const { return std::vector<field>(begin(), end()); }
};
